2022-01-08dt-bindings: input/ts/zinitix: Convert to YAML, fix and extendLinus Walleij
This converts the Zinitix BT4xx and BT5xx touchscreen bindings to YAML, fix them up a bit and extends them. We list all the existing BT4xx and BT5xx components with compatible strings. These are all similar, use the same bindings and work in similar ways. We rename the supplies from the erroneous vdd/vddo to the actual supply names vcca/vdd as specified on the actual component. It is long established that supplies shall be named after the supply pin names of a component. The confusion probably stems from that in a certain product the rails to the component were named vdd/vddo. Drop some notes on how OS implementations should avoid confusion by first looking for vddo, and if that exists assume the legacy binding pair and otherwise use vcca/vdd. Add reset-gpios as sometimes manufacturers pulls a GPIO line to the reset line on the chip. Add optional touchscreen-fuzz-x and touchscreen-fuzz-y properties. 2021-06-01dt-bindings: input: touchscreen: edt-ft5x06: add iovcc-supplyStephan Gerhold
At the moment, the edt-ft5x06 driver can control a single regulator ("vcc"). However, some FocalTech touch controllers have an additional IOVCC pin that should be supplied with the digital I/O voltage. The I/O voltage might be provided by another regulator that should also be kept on. Otherwise, the touchscreen can randomly stop functioning if the regulator is turned off because no other components still require it. Document (optional) support for controlling the regulator for IOVCC using "iovcc-supply".
